The move came after three days of intensive talks that had made progress on some tariffs but failed to resolve major differences over market access and retaliatory duties.The US is preparing to impose tariffs of up to 50% on Canadian goods, while Carney said Canada would respond with matching tariffs, raising the risk of further disruption to deeply integrated North American supply chains. Read full storyPakistan deploys army in Rawalpindi amid security concernsPakistan has authorised the deployment of three companies of the army in Rawalpindi for six months under Article 245 of the Constitution, following a request from the Punjab home department for “sensitive security duties”. The move comes days after a shooting involving a man whom state-run media described as an active PTI member, though the party denied any connection to the incident.The deployment is significant as Rawalpindi is home to the Pakistan Army’s General Headquarters and is a key military and administrative centre. ‘Sometimes dynastic politics has its benefits’: Akhilesh on how 5 family MPs helped SP

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av said the party would remain intact even if some MPs defected, pointing to the presence of five members of his family among its MPs as one source of strength. He also reaffirmed the SP’s commitment to its alliances and said the party’s broader goal was to build a government based on socialist principles and social justice, with the PDA — backward classes, Dalits and minorities — at its centre.Yadav also attacked the BJP over rising prices, education and welfare policies, while alleging that journalists were facing pressure to avoid speaking openly. Newborn dies after warmer catches fire at Madhya Pradesh hospital

A newborn died and two others were injured after a warmer machine allegedly caught fire at the district hospital in Chhindwara early Saturday. Hospital officials said the three babies were initially treated before being referred to Jabalpur, while the administration ordered an inquiry into the cause of the blaze.The incident has also drawn criticism from Madhya Pradesh Assembly Leader of Opposition Umang Singhar, who called for fire safety audits of hospitals across the state. Two dead after seven-storey building collapses in Hyderabad

A seven-storey under-construction building collapsed in Madhapur’s Anjaiah Nagar on Saturday afternoon, killing at least two people and injuring two others. HYDRAA teams searching the debris found a body and said they suspected another person could still be trapped.The building was reportedly being constructed on a 50-square-yard plot, with officials also examining the impact on nearby structures.
